Course Details

• Future Trends in Inflight Dining: Understanding the evolving customer preferences, emerging technology, and sustainability in the aviation food industry.
• Culinary Innovations for Inflight Dining: Exploring new techniques, ingredients, and presentation styles to enhance the inflight dining experience.
• Nutrition and Health-Conscious Inflight Dining: Designing menus that cater to various dietary requirements, including vegan, gluten-free, and low-sodium options.
• Customer Experience Management in Inflight Dining: Implementing strategies to improve customer satisfaction, loyalty, and brand reputation.
• Supply Chain Management for Inflight Dining: Optimizing the sourcing, production, and distribution of food and beverages to reduce waste and costs.
• Sustainable Practices in Inflight Dining: Adopting eco-friendly approaches to food preparation, packaging, and disposal.
• Inflight Beverage Trends and Innovations: Exploring new beverage options, such as craft beers, artisanal cocktails, and healthy drinks, to complement food offerings.
• Technology Integration in Inflight Dining: Leveraging data analytics, mobile apps, and contactless payment systems to enhance the inflight dining experience.
• Regulations and Compliance in Inflight Dining: Navigating the complex web of food safety, labeling, and alcohol service regulations in the aviation industry.
